Thanks very much for reporting this problem. Unfortunately bugs in the
libiberty library, including the C++ name demangler, should be reported
to the GCC project and not the binutils.
(https://gcc.gnu.org/bugzilla/enter_bug.cgi?product=gcc component = demangler).
The libiberty library is used by the binutils project, but it is not
owned by it. We try to keep the sources in the binutils repository
in sync with the sources in the gcc repository, but there is no formal
process for doing this. So sometimes it may happen that a bug has been
fixed in the gcc sources, but the patch has not yet been imported into
the binutils sources. If you find that this is the case, please do let
us know so that we can fix the problem.
